9 Commits

Author SHA1 Message Date
leitner
9af06ac843 remove can't happen code and instead force a compile time error 2014-03-15 12:38:10 +00:00
leitner
baec005507 improved code path for typical platforms where there is a wider integer type 2014-03-14 21:32:29 +00:00
leitner
08ba483bfb catch other potential overflow 2014-03-14 20:35:47 +00:00
leitner
d14d2536f0 get rid of -Wconversion warnings 2014-03-14 02:15:38 +00:00
leitner
01ffc04006 do proper early abort in the other scan_* routines if the numeric value
is too large
2014-03-14 00:24:02 +00:00
leitner
3004b518ef switch to size_t and ssize_t 2006-11-07 17:56:05 +00:00
leitner
85bfbeb420 only write dest if we actually parsed something 2003-09-19 14:54:40 +00:00
leitner
36c6f04ed9 scan_uint and scan_ushort will now abort if the result does not fit in
uint or ushort as opposed to ulong.
2003-06-08 20:01:11 +00:00
leitner
3083708670 Initial revision 2001-02-02 17:54:47 +00:00